Pomacea canaliculata orchid information, .
Pomacea canaliculata is unplaced species in  the family Ampullariidae  subfamily: Pomaceinae,  
Genus Pomacea 
Pomacea canaliculata H. Zell
Pomacea canaliculata Timothy A Rawlings
Pomacea canaliculata Claytonc1997
more ...